Oversized Load Truck Accidents specialist record holder

Preserve the evidence that makes this incident type different

For oversized load truck accidents in Ontario, the focused review should include carrier dispatch, driver qualification, electronic logging, inspection, maintenance, loading, and onboard-data records. Service-specific proof

What changes in a oversized load truck accidents review

Oversized-load crashes often involve permit rules, escort vehicles, route planning, and multiple commercial entities rather than a single negligent driver.

  • Oversize permits, route approvals, and escort-vehicle documentation.
  • Photos showing lane encroachment, clearance limits, or cargo overhang.
  • Carrier communications about timing pressure, route changes, or safety planning.
